History of Beachmere
Beachmere was mainly a fishing community when it was settled by Europeans. The area's name is thought to have been given by a European settler, Thomas Edwin Bonney, who named it after his early residence. Bonney arrived in 1870 and is believed to be the first European Australian settler in the area. Over the years, Beachmere has grown and developed, becoming a thriving suburb with a strong sense of community.

The Natural Beauty of Beachmere
Beachmere is blessed with stunning natural assets, making it a haven for outdoor enthusiasts. The suburb is located at the mouth of the Caboolture River, where it enters Deception Bay. It is positioned on a small peninsula formed by the river and the bay, offering beautiful views and a tranquil atmosphere. The area also features a strip of sandy beach set among marshy countryside, providing a picturesque backdrop for leisurely walks and beach activities.
Activities and Interests of Residents in Beachmere
Residents of Beachmere enjoy a variety of hobbies and interests, taking advantage of the suburb's natural surroundings. Some popular activities include:
- Boat and Watercraft Fun: Beachmere offers a two-lane boat ramp and pontoon, providing easy access to the Caboolture River, Pumicestone Passage, Burpengary Creek, Deception Bay, Scarborough, and Moreton Island. Boat hire places are available nearby in Sandstone Point and on Bribie Island.
- Horse Riding: Beachmere is close to the Queensland State Equestrian Centre in Caboolture, and riders and their horses can often be seen trotting along the waterfront at low tide.
- Family Fun in the Sun: Moreton Terrace Park offers a great spot for families to enjoy picnics and beach activities. Kids can play on the beach, make sandcastles, wade in the shallow waters, and watch soldier crabs at low tide.
- Dog Walks: Beachmere provides both off-leash and on-leash dog-friendly areas along the foreshore, allowing residents to enjoy walks with their furry friends.
- Nearby Walks at Godwin Beach: The Godwin Beach Environmental Reserve, located between Sandstone Point and Beachmere, offers a peaceful setting for leisurely walks through various vegetation habitats.
